Join me in an exploration of the most "monumental" Victorian cemeteries in London . Known as " The Magnificent Seven " they were all built outside the City to accommodate the growing number of London's dead .
Highgate is the best known, the burial place of many famous names from Karl Marx to George Michael , but there are many more hidden charms in the other six - Kensal Green, the best way to Paradise according to a famous poem , West Norwood , the resting place of the famous Victorian cook Mrs Beeton and many more , some famous and some forgotten.
We will also explore the Victorian culture regarding death and burial and some of its more bizarre customs such as post mortem photography.
